#d1bf18 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d1bf18 is composed of 82% red, 74.9% green and 9.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 8.6% magenta, 88.5% yellow and 18% black. It has a hue angle of 54.2 degrees, a saturation of 79.4% and a lightness of 45.7%. #d1bf18 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ff30 with #a37f00. Closest websafe color is: #cccc00.

Shades and Tints of #d1bf18
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0f0e02 is the darkest color, while #fffffd is the lightest one.
